Your Kingdom Come

Your kingdom come, your will be done, in ME as it is in heaven.

We’ve all heard or used the phrase, “Heaven on Earth”. But what does Heaven on Earth look like? Is it a world where our checkbooks balance themselves and puppies stay young and cute forever? Maybe…but maybe we’re thinking too small.

As we examine this week’s verse in The Lord’s Prayer, we contemplate what the world would look like if it worked the way God intended. If Heaven is the sphere where God’s will is perfectly followed, then wherever Heaven is peace reigns, justice holds sway, and love is the rule obeyed. But that isn’t the state of our world now. The bible says the world is not quite how it’s supposed to be. However beautiful it is, it is not quite how God made it.

So, when we pray “Your kingdom come, Your will be done,” we pray God will heal our world and heal our wounds. We pray for God’s will to be done in us as in heaven.
